About Arend Koch

Arend Koch is a scholar working on Genetics, Neurology, Cancer Research, Molecular Biology and Developmental Neuroscience, having authored 85 papers that have together received 2.6k indexed citations. Recurring topics across this work include Glioma Diagnosis and Treatment (32 papers), Hedgehog Signaling Pathway Studies (14 papers), Epigenetics and DNA Methylation (13 papers), Neuroblastoma Research and Treatments (8 papers), Meningioma and schwannoma management (8 papers), Brain Metastases and Treatment (6 papers), Cancer-related gene regulation (6 papers) and Cancer, Hypoxia, and Metabolism (6 papers). The work is most often cited by research in Genetics (848 citations), Cancer Research (421 citations), Neurology (333 citations), Molecular Biology (1.4k citations) and Oncology (415 citations). Arend Koch has collaborated with scholars based in Germany, United States and Switzerland. Frequent co-authors include Torsten Pietsch, Wolfgang Hartmann, Dietrich von Schweinitz, Anke Waha, Otmar D. Wiestler, Ulrich Schüller, Andreas Waha, Frank L. Heppner, Martin Misch and Elmar Endl. Their work appears in journals such as International Journal of Cancer, Child s Nervous System, Acta Neuropathologica, Journal of Neuro-Oncology and Clinical Cancer Research.
